Advertisement
Polma

Contoh Program Pengurangan pada Matriks

Nov 5th, 2013
3,115
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Pascal 1.51 KB | None | 0 0
  1. program pengurangan_matrik;
  2. uses crt;
  3. type data = array[1..10,1..10] of integer;
  4. var matrikI,matrikII : data;
  5.     baris,kolom,pil : integer;
  6.     Ul : char;
  7.  
  8. procedure isimatrik;
  9. var i,j : integer;
  10. begin
  11.  write ('Ukuran Matriks (a x a) : '); readln(baris);
  12.  writeln;
  13.      writeln ('A =');
  14.      writeln;
  15.       for i:=1 to baris do
  16.          begin
  17.          for j :=1 to baris do
  18.              begin
  19.                   gotoxy (j*5,i+8);
  20.                   read(matrikI[i,j]);
  21.              end;
  22.          end;
  23.      writeln;
  24.      writeln('B =');
  25.      writeln;
  26.      for i:=1 to baris do
  27.          begin
  28.          for j:=1 to baris do
  29.              begin
  30.                   gotoxy(j*5,i+12);
  31.                   read(matrikII[i,j]);
  32.              end;
  33.          end;
  34. end;
  35.  
  36.  
  37. procedure kurangmatrik(m1,m2 : data);
  38. var hasil : data;
  39.     i,j : integer;
  40. begin
  41.      for i:=1 to baris do
  42.          for j:=1 to baris do
  43.              begin
  44.                   hasil[i,j]:=m1[i,j]-m2[i,j];
  45.              end;
  46.      writeln;
  47.      writeln('Output : A-B = ');
  48.  
  49.      for i:=1 to baris do
  50.          for j:=1 to baris do
  51.              begin
  52.                   gotoxy(j*5,i+17);
  53.                   write(hasil[i,j]);
  54.              end;
  55. readln;
  56. end;
  57.  
  58. begin
  59. clrscr;
  60.   writeln('Program : Pengurangan pada Matriks');
  61.   writeln('Polma Saut Martua Sihotang');
  62.   writeln('118130023 / IK-37-01');
  63.   writeln('Telkom University');
  64.   writeln;
  65.   writeln;
  66.               isimatrik;
  67.               kurangmatrik(matrikI,matrikII);
  68. readln;
  69. end.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ement